A Spacious Home in Kagoshima's Serene Kinkodai
This 95.31㎡ property in Kagoshima City's Kinkodai 1-chome offers a generous 4LDK layout, providing ample space for comfortable living. Built in 1973, the wooden two-story house sits on a 150.94㎡ plot of land in a quiet residential neighborhood. The property includes parking for two vehicles, a valuable feature in urban Japan.
The surrounding Kinkodai area is known for its peaceful atmosphere and family-friendly environment. The neighborhood is within walking distance of Kinkodai Elementary School and offers convenient access to local amenities. An interesting local fact is that Kagoshima City is built at the base of the active Sakurajima volcano, which frequently provides spectacular ash-plume displays that can be seen from various points throughout the city.
The closest major tourist attraction is the iconic Sakurajima volcano itself, accessible via ferry from Kagoshima City. This active stratovolcano dominates the landscape of Kagoshima Bay and offers visitors hiking trails, observation points, and unique volcanic hot springs.
